Job Summary
About the Role:
We're the Camera Platform team, powering the backend for the video devices in our Smart Home / Connected Living organization. As Smart Home rapidly expands its lineup of connected devices, our charter is growing with it: we're building the platform that turns 3rd-party device onboarding from a series of bespoke integrations into a repeatable, scalable capability - enhancing home security and peace of mind for Comcast customers. The work goes beyond connecting any single device: you'll help build the abstractions and patterns that bring a growing ecosystem of devices online reliably through cloud-to-cloud API and event-driven integrations. This is a Go/AWS-first role: net-new development is in Go, and you'll implement integrations, contribute to the platform patterns the team is establishing, and own components end-to-end as the team grows.

Job Description
What You'll Do
  • Design and build scalable, high-concurrency backend services in Go on AWS (Lambda, EC2, DynamoDB, SNS/SQS, SSM)
  • Implement integrations with external cloud platforms via APIs and event/callback models - working with auth/token lifecycle, API contracts and versioning, and rate limits - contributing to the frameworks and patterns that make onboarding repeatable
  • Work with core device-platform concepts - device identity, capabilities, commands, events, state synchronization, and onboarding/deprovisioning - as you build and operate integrations
  • Contribute to mapping device capabilities into our platform, working with technical and business teams
  • Build resilient, event-driven integrations on top of third-party systems - handling async event processing, idempotency, retries, partial failure, and state reconciliation
  • Provide maintenance and support for our existing Java/Spring Boot platform during an ongoing transition, while net-new development is Go/AWS-first
  • Contribute to performance tuning, reliability, and observability improvements
  • Build and ship using AI-assisted development tools as part of day-to-day engineering
  • Participate in architecture and design discussions
  • Take ownership of features and components end-to-end
